Reef Connections: U.S. Classrooms
Bring marine conservation to life in your classroom. Through our collaboration with BICA (Bay Islands Conservation Association), U.S. schools can connect directly with educators and reef experts in Roatán for interactive Zoom sessions, project-based learning, and global enrichment opportunities.
Whether you're teaching ecology, sustainability, or global citizenship, your students can engage with real-world environmental work and even help raise awareness to protect the reef.
